    Group of five elephants creating ruckus

    A group of five elephants is creating a ruckus in the forest of Marwahi adjacent to the Achanakmar Tiger Reserve. Similar is the situation in Ambikapur area. Two days ago, a group of 6 elephants present in Chhaparwa range of Achanakmar Tiger Reserve has also started a stir. They had reached near the village but due to the vigilance of the villagers, they did not enter the village.

    Due to ready crops in Marwahi and Ambikapur area, the attack of elephants has increased. The group of 5 elephants has been divided into 2 groups in Marwahi Forest Division. Two elephants are present in Ghusuria beet and a group of three elephants are present in Marwahi beet. Elephants have not come towards the village since two days but are damaging the crops in the fields. Paddy is the favorite food of elephants. The summer paddy is cooked. It has also been cut and kept at some places. In such a situation, elephants are coming towards the village to eat it. Apart from this, the season of Mahua has also ended recently. Villagers in the tribal areas also make liquor from Mahua, elephants are attracted to that too. As soon as the elephant menace started in Marwahi forest division, the ATR management started preparing for the rescue of their village.

  • Collector took cognizance of Congress leader’s hooliganism on farmer

    Collector took cognizance of Congress leader’s hooliganism on farmer

    Bilaspur. Collector Saurabh Kumar has taken immediate cognizance of the written complaint made by Mopka resident Umendra Sahu regarding the possession of land. Following the instructions of the Collector, the SDM has ordered to maintain the status quo on the spot.

    Farmer Umendra Sahu had given a written complaint on June 23 that his land located in village Mopka has been leveled by breaking the med of Khasra No. 1357 and mixed with his land by the nearby land holders Sheru Aslam and Mohsin Khan, and is threatening him. That this land is his own land. Taking the complaint seriously, the Collector circulated a letter to Bilaspur SDM to take immediate action. Taking cognizance of the complaint letter, SDM Bilaspur has issued an order under section 145 CrPC to maintain status quo on the spot, as well as called both the parties to the office on June 28 with their respective documents for hearing. Along with this, police have been written to take cognizance of the incident and report to Bilaspur Municipal Corporation for taking legal action regarding irregular development.

    In the complaint letter, farmer Umed Sahu has complained against Sheru Aslam, but notice has been issued to Mohsin Khan because the land is in the name of Mohsin Khan. Along with this police station Sarkanda has submitted a report of preventive action against Sheru Aslam.

  • Vicious women flew away with gold mangalsutra, cheated by luring commission

    Vicious women flew away with gold mangalsutra, cheated by luring commission

    Bilaspur. Women’s thug gang is active in Bilaspur, who are continuously carrying out the incidents of thugs. This gang is roaming in the surrounding areas of the city in the name of changing utensils. On this pretext, they are cheating women by taking them into confidence and promising to show their jewelry designs in the company and get commission. In one such case, the Sakri police have registered a case against the woman.

    Lakshmi Yadav husband Raju Yadav (34) living in Lokhandi of Sakri area is a housewife. He told in his complaint that a few days ago three women came to his place to clean bronze and brass utensils. The women also offered to give them new utensils in exchange for the old ones. On this, he also took a new utensil instead of his old brass utensil.

    Then other women reached her. During this, women told that their company has an offer, in which if the company likes the design of their jewelry, they will get commission. For this, their jewelry has to be shown in the company. The woman came under his trust and gave him her gold mangalsutra, earrings, some silver ornaments. After this the women disappeared with the ornaments. On their complaint, the police have registered a case and started searching for the women.

  • Hostel superintendent’s feat, students held hostage to hide failure

    Hostel superintendent’s feat, students held hostage to hide failure

    Bilaspur. A case of hostage taking of students has come to the fore in Prayas Residential School of Bilaspur. When the students studying here were about to go to the collector complaining about the conditions, their hostel superintendent took them hostage by locking the hostel from all sides. The students somehow came out by breaking the lock. Then walking 12 kilometers in the scorching sun reached the collector and complained to the collector.

    Prayas Residential School is located at Ramtala, Bilaspur. There are two residential schools for boys and girls separately. Admission in Prayas Residential School, which operates from ninth to twelfth, is given on the basis of entrance examination. By keeping the students here, along with school studies, preparations are made for IIT JEE and NEET. The government bears the cost of boarding and lodging of the students. The government has opened Prayas residential school so that the talented children of poor and remote areas can stay and study here. This year, 15 students have been selected in JEE and 22 in NEET from Prayas Residential School. Yesterday the students here reached on foot to meet Collector Saurabh Kumar. The students said that the food served here is of very poor quality. Bread is not served with food. Also insects are found in breakfast. Hostel fans are bad, when asked to get them made, it is told by the hostel superintendent that you people do not have the status to live in an AC cooler.
